About Atos Group
Atos Group is a global leader in digital transformation with c. 67,000 employees and annual revenue of c. €10 billion, operating in 61 countries under two brands - Atos for services and Eviden for products. European number one in cybersecurity, cloud and high performance computing, Atos Group is committed to a secure and decarbonized future and provides tailored AI-powered, end-to-end solutions for all industries.
About the Role
As a Scrum Master, you will act as a coach and facilitator rather than a traditional manager, guiding teams through Scrum ceremonies, removing impediments, and fostering a culture of collaboration, accountability, and continuous improvement. You will work with long-term customer engagements, primarily within government and public sector environments, supporting multiple Agile teams and helping organizations deliver high-quality IT services and solutions.
Responsibilities
- Support Agile and DevOps teams in applying Scrum principles and Agile ways of working
- Facilitate Scrum ceremonies, including Daily Stand-ups, Sprint Planning, Sprint Reviews, Retrospectives, and Backlog Refinement sessions
- Help foster collaboration, transparency, and continuous improvement within Scrum teams
- Assist in identifying and removing impediments that affect team delivery
- Work closely with Product Owners, developers, and stakeholders to support successful Sprint outcomes
- Encourage Agile best practices and contribute to improving team maturity
- Monitor team progress and help identify opportunities for process improvements
- Support communication between technical teams and business stakeholders
- Learn from and collaborate with senior Scrum Masters and Agile Coaches where applicable
- Contribute to Agile initiatives across the organization
